Output bdca159dab025e28593b9c95008df1b243c1c9cd40b6af074cd14d943a458cbc:21

value
321913682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34a6c051c9a457cacc968a8a00d64feb360c3c41 OP_EQUAL
address
MChZ8V6TSnStEw3HukVH19Szb3v9PN2dQP
transaction
bdca159dab025e28593b9c95008df1b243c1c9cd40b6af074cd14d943a458cbc
spent
true